Rain Delay Performance

The rainfall delay capability in modern-day sprinkler systems automatically puts on hold scheduled watering to protect against unnecessary water use when rain is imminent. This attribute makes use of weather-responsive technology, commonly incorporated with clever sensors that discover rainfall levels. By keeping track of neighborhood weather condition patterns, the system can readjust its watering routine in real-time, making sure that plants receive perfect hydration without the threat of overwatering. Therefore, house owners can save water and decrease watering costs while preserving healthy and balanced landscapes. In addition, the rainfall delay function advertises environmental sustainability by lessening overflow and reducing the problem on metropolitan water systems. Implementing this cutting-edge attribute exhibits the commitment to efficient source administration in contemporary watering techniques.

Dirt Dampness Sensors



Dirt moisture sensors play a vital role in modern watering systems, giving real-time data that boosts water efficiency. These tools gauge the volumetric water web content in the dirt, allowing for specific evaluations of wetness levels. By incorporating dirt wetness sensing units into watering systems, customers can prevent overwatering or underwatering, ultimately advertising healthier plant development and preserving water resources.The sensing units send information to controllers, which can adjust sprinkling routines based upon current dirt problems. This data-driven technique decreases water waste and warranties that plants receive the finest quantity of moisture. Additionally, soil wetness sensing units can be beneficial in numerous farming settings, from home yards to massive ranches. The deployment of these sensors adds to sustainable methods by supporting liable water use and reducing environmental influence. On the whole, the unification of dirt wetness sensors notes a significant advancement in accomplishing effective irrigation systems.

What Is the Life-span of Modern Lawn Sprinkler System Elements?





The life-span of modern-day lawn sprinkler system components generally varies from 5 to twenty years, depending upon the materials utilized, upkeep methods, and environmental problems. Regular upkeep can substantially boost resilience and performance with time.
